About

Portia Capital Management serves high-net-worth individuals, families, trusts and institutional clients, including defined contribution and defined benefit plans, foundations and endowments. The firm provides comprehensive financial planning and portfolio management along with related services such as tax preparation and planning, estate planning consultation, risk management, retirement planning and business succession planning, and plan consulting and participant education for institutional sponsors.

Investment decisions are made using a research-driven, asset-allocation emphasis, with portfolios built from proprietary “Recommended” and “Approved” lists informed by third‑party data providers (Morningstar, Zephyr, Bloomberg) and periodic rebalancing. The firm emphasizes manager selection and risk management, and may use a mix of individual securities, mutual funds, ETFs, separate account managers and, when appropriate, alternative and private investments to achieve targeted exposures.

Noteworthy for a firm of its size, Portia operates with a two-advisor team and manages roughly $65.7 million in client assets, with a stated $500,000 account minimum that orients the practice toward wealthier and institutional clients. The firm also offers less common services for a small advisory firm — including tax preparation, hourly consulting and help locating EB‑5 visa investment opportunities — and its leadership includes a CFA charterholder who remains active in academic instruction.

Fee options

Fixed

Negotiated fixed fees for projects requiring more than 10 hours

Percentage

$500,000+: 0.50% to 1.00% annually, negotiated individually

Project-based

Hourly fee of $250/hour

Other

Account minimum: $500,000 Minimum fee: Minimum annual fee of $5,000 Fee-only: Hourly fee of $250/hour; fixed fees negotiable for larger projects
